I'm sure it'll be ok, once it starts - that's when it gets easier Thread: viewtopic.php?f=31&t=66299 Slab: 16/6/14 Frame: 4/7/14 Roof: 22/7/14 Lock Up: 20/8/14 Fixing: 26/8/14 PCI: 9/10/14 Handover: 20/10/14 Re: Statesman-Greenock at Elizabeth Park - ok to constructio 46Mar 12, 2014 3:05 pm Yes, that sounds like normal practice. It does make sense too when you think about the poor SS who could have more than 100 jobs to oversee from north to south, east to west, involving a lot of time on the road as well as at the sites--not much consolation for you being the one who has to pay for it all. Write to the customer service rep. assigned to your job and follow up if there is no answer within a reasonable time (we usually allowed five working days). This approach worked for us most of the time. We learned from "the hole" in our slab that the SS takes on the job only once the slab has been poured and the frame is in place. It wasn't until the hole and prodding from us for an explanation as to how the hole would be rectified without compromising the slab for guarantees etc. that we were able to speak to our SS. I hope you don't have to experience a hole, by the way. After the slab and frame went up, we were able to visit every day too, so that helped us know what was happening. We'd often see something and receive notification the following week--and that helped us know when to expect a request for the next payment. I think you can request a walk through before making payments, but you'd need to check your paperwork to make sure as it might apply only to the later payments.
